SABIC's Specialties Business LNP ELCRES CRX9421 is a semi-crystalline Polycarbonate (PC) copolymer/Polybutylene Terephthalate (PBT) opaque blend. This grade offers medium flow, UL V0 rating @ 1.5 mm, and high ductility in combination with excellent chemical resistance. It is available for custom coloring and may be an excellent candidate for a wide variety of applications that need improved chemical resistance.

Improved Chemical Resistance Materials for Medical Enclosures and Housings


With patient safety at the forefront, the healthcare industry is mobilizing to address the concerns of increasing patient infections associated with medical care, known as hospital-acquired infections (HAIs). To help meet this challenge, medical equipment and high touch surfaces in patient care settings are repeatedly wiped down with increasingly aggressive chemical disinfectants.

Chemical Resistance Data - Environmental Stress Cracking (ESC) Performance

Compared to traditional PC, ABS, PBT and co-polyester resins and blends which are potentially incompatible with highly aggressive disinfectants such as quaternary ammonium compounds the new LNP ELCRES CRX resins can help prevent stress cracking and mitigate crack propagation.

SABIC’s LNP ELCRES CRX resins leverage unique copolymer technology to provide improved chemical resistance for healthcare devices and equipment, compared to existing materials used such as PC/ABS, PC/PBT, or co-polyester resins and blends.

Plastics Determination of Resistance to ESC Method

SABIC’s Environmental Stress Cracking (ESC) method evaluates retention of tensile properties vs. control for up to 7 days.

SABIC ESC Method:
per ASTM D543

Strain Level: 1% Strain

Exposure conditions: 23°C
